CUET UG 2026 Exam Pattern and Marking Scheme
Candidates appearing for the examination must understand the latest exam structure and marking criteria. The CUET UG question papers are based on the revised exam pattern prescribed by NTA. Check the important exam details below.
|
Particulars |
Details |
|
Number of Questions |
50 |
|
Exam Duration |
60 Minutes |
|
Total Marks |
250 |
|
Optional Questions |
No |
|
Exam Mode |
CBT Mode |
The following marking scheme will be followed for evaluation.
|
Response Type |
Marks |
|
Correct Answer |
+5 Marks |
|
Incorrect Answer |
-1 Mark |
|
Unattempted Question |
0 Marks |

CUET UG 2026 Paper Analysis
Students reported that most questions were NCERT-based and concept-driven. Several sections included statement-based and match-the-column questions. Check the important CUET UG paper analysis below.
|
Subject |
Key Topics Asked |
|
English |
Phrasal verbs, vocabulary, RC passages |
|
Mathematics |
Integrals, differential equations, matrices |
|
Physics |
Current electricity, electromagnetic concepts |
|
Chemistry |
Organic chemistry, name reactions |
|
Accountancy |
Partnership, capital adjustment |
|
General Test |
GK, reasoning, current affairs |

CUET UG 2026 Exam Day Guidelines
Students must carry all required documents while reporting to the examination centre. Entry to the examination hall is allowed only after verification and frisking procedures. Candidates should keep the following documents ready before reaching the exam centre.
- CUET UG 2026 Admit Card
- Valid photo identity proof
- Passport-size photograph
- Transparent water bottle
- Required stationery items
NTA is expected to release the official CUET UG 2026 answer key after the completion of all examination shifts.

CUET UG 2026 Science Subjects Mostly NCERT-Based
Students stated that Physics and Chemistry papers mainly followed NCERT concepts with fewer numerical questions. Important observations are mentioned below.
- Organic Chemistry had maximum questions
- Physics theory questions dominated
- Few numerical questions asked
- Current electricity important in Physics
